Malicious websites promising leaked Snapchats are still around, which is why users looking for raunchy photos sent via Snapchat should be careful. Back in December 2013, security experts warned of a website called leaked-snapchatz.com. While this particular website is blocked by Google and antivirus vendors, a new one has been registered to take its place. […]
